Get started21 Connaught Avenue is a semi-detached house in East Barnet, Barnet, Barnet (EN4 8PJ). It has a recorded floor area of 62 m² (around 667 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(May 2019) shows a D (score 66),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. When first surveyed in January 2013 the rating was E,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, window efficiency went from Average to Good, hot-water efficiency went from Average to Good and lighting went from Very Poor to Very Good; while roof efficiency dropped from Very Good to Good.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 84), a 2-band jump.
Sale prices here have outpaced Barnet HPI: 5.5% per year against 0% for the wider region.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£959/sq ft) was about 142.6% above the typical sold price in the postcode. A recent sale: £640,000 in November 2024. One planning record on file: an extension approved in 2013. Past consents include an extension,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. At 62 m² it's 17.3% smaller than the typical home in the postcode (75 m² median across 16 EPCs).
